Ingredients
– 1 cup graham cracker crumbs
– 2 tablespoons granulated sugar
– ½ cup unsalted butter, melted
– 8 oz cream cheese, softened
– ½ cup powdered sugar
– 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
– 1 cup heavy whipping cream
– Fresh berries, chocolate shavings, or your favorite toppings (for serving)
Instructions
Making No-Bake Cheesecake Cups is a straightforward process. Follow these simple steps to create your delicious dessert:
1. Prepare the Crust: In a medium bowl, combine graham cracker crumbs, granulated sugar, and melted butter. Stir until the mixture resembles wet sand.
2. Layer the Crust: Take small cups or jars and scoop the crust mixture evenly into the bottom of each cup. Press down firmly to ensure it holds shape.
3. Make the Cheesecake Filling: In a large bowl, beat the softened cream cheese until smooth. Gradually add in powdered sugar and vanilla extract, mixing until well combined.
4. Whip the Cream: In a separate bowl, whip the heavy cream until stiff peaks form. Gently fold the whipped cream into the cheesecake mixture, being careful not to deflate the airy texture.
5. Fill the Cups: Scoop the cheesecake filling into each cup over the crust layer. Smooth the top with a spatula or spoon.
6. Chill: Cover the cups with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 4 hours or until set.
7. Add Toppings: Once chilled, add your favorite toppings right before serving. Berries, chocolate shavings, or a drizzle of caramel add a beautiful and delicious finish.
